Oracle 手动创建数据库

Oracle 管理

手工建数据库Oracle

1.创建实例

c:>oradim –new –sid book

2.初始化参数文件

复制原有的默认数据库的pfile文件,打开将里面的sid替换成book,保存为intbook.ora;

3.创建相应的目录结构

c:>…\10.2.0\admin\md book

在book文件夹下md adump bdump cdump dpdump pfile udump

4.创建口令验证文件

Orapwd file=I:\oracle\product\10.2.0\db_1\database\pwdbook.ora

Password=admin entries=1

5.执行建数据库的脚本

注意是在startup nomount状态下

Create database book

Datafile ‘I:\oracle\product\10.2.0\oradata\book\system01.dbf’ size 300M

Sysaux datafile ‘I:\oracle\product\10.2.0\oradata\book\sysaux01.dbf’ size 120M

Default temporary tablespace temp tempfile ‘I:\oracle\product\10.2.0\oradata\book\temp01.dbf’ size  20M

Undo tablespace UNDOTBS1 datafile ‘I:\oracle\product\10.2.0\oradata\book\undotbs01.dbf ’ size 200M

Logfile

Group 1 (‘I:\oracle\product\10.2.0\oradata\book\redo01.log’) size 10240K,

Group 2 (‘I:\oracle\product\10.2.0\oradata\book\redo02.log’) size 10240K,

Group 3 (‘I:\oracle\product\10.2.0\oradata\book\redo03.log’) size 10240K

6.创建数据字典视图

执行sql:SQL>@’ I:\oracle\product\10.2.0\db_1\RDBMS\ADMIN\catalog.sql’

7.创建内部包

执行sql:SQL>@’ I:\oracle\product\10.2.0\db_1\RDBMS\ADMIN\catproc.sql’

8.创建scott用户

用system登陆 执行SQL>@’ I:\oracle\product\10.2.0\db_1\RDBMS\ADMIN\scott.sql’

9.创建spfile

Create spfile from pfile;

10.配置监听和服务名

如有疑问请加QQ494960120

原文地址:https://www.cnblogs.com/FeiyueHang/p/1987313.html